As a school-based OT, you will work closely with students, teachers, and special education staff to assess, plan, and implement therapy services that support students' ability to participate fully in their educational environment. Your role will involve enhancing fine motor skills, sensory integration, self-care capabilities, and classroom access strategies for students with varying needs.
